Structure of the IELTS Speaking Test

The IELTS Exam Format Saudi Arabia Speaking Test is divided into 3 parts:

48d055d0-701c-43c4-9b7c-de4dcc94ac26-removebg-preview-160x160.png
PartPeriodDescription
Part 1: Introduction and Interview4-5 minutesThe examiner presents themselves and asks the candidate to introduce themselves and provide some standard info about their life, interests, and background.
Part 2: Long Turn3-4 minutesThe candidate is offered a job card with a subject, which they need to speak about for 1-2 minutes. They have one minute to prepare their action.
Part 3: Two-Way Discussion4-5 minutesThe inspector engages the prospect in a conversation that is more abstract and connected to the subject from Part 2.

By comprehending the structure, prospects can much better prepare and feel more comfy throughout the test.

Sample Questions for IELTS Speaking Test in Saudi Arabia

Part 1: Introduction and Interview

In this very first part, the examiner will ask general questions about the candidate's life and experiences. Here are some sample questions that candidates in Saudi Arabia might encounter:

  1. Can you tell me your name and where you are from?
  2. What do you provide for a living?
  3. What do you like to do in your spare time?
  4. How frequently do you visit your home town?
  5. Is it simple to make good friends in Saudi Arabia?

Part 2: Long Turn

In Part 2, the prospect will get a task card with a particular topic. They will have one minute to prepare and should intend to talk for 1-2 minutes. Here are a couple of example topics together with triggers:

TopicPrompt
A Traditional FestivalDescribe a conventional celebration in Saudi Arabia. You should say:
- What the festival is
- How it is popular
- What you like or dislike about it
A Memorable JourneyExplain a memorable journey you have actually taken. You need to include:
- Where you went
- Who you traveled with
- What made it unforgettable

Part 3: Two-Way Discussion

In the last part, the inspector will ask more thought-provoking questions related to the topic gone over in Part 2. Here are some sample questions that could be asked:

  1. How do traditional festivals reflect a country's culture?
  2. What role does tourist play in promoting cultural heritage?
  3. In what methods do you think social networks has altered the way we celebrate celebrations?
  4. Do you think it's important to maintain traditional events? Why or why not?
  5. How can take a trip broaden a person's perspective?

FAQ

1. How is the IELTS Speaking Test graded?

The IELTS Test Center In Saudi Arabia Speaking Test is graded on four criteria: fluency and coherence, lexical resource, grammatical range and precision, and pronunciation.

2. Can I utilize notes during the Speaking Test?

No, prospects are not allowed to use notes or any other help throughout the Speaking Test.

3. What should I do if I don't understand a question?

If you don't understand a question, it is perfectly acceptable to ask the examiner to repeat or clarify it.

4. How long is the Speaking Test?

The Speaking Test normally lasts between 11 to 14 minutes.
